This is a Giant 3/4" Scale Balsa SBD-3 Dauntless Flying Model Kit
from Guillow's.
For Experienced Modelers.
Fulfilling the attack role assigned to it at its conception, the SBD,
operating from the decks of the carriers Lexington, Yorktown, Wasp and Enter-
prise, mortally damaged the main units of the Japanese carrier fleet and set
the stage for the ultimate Allied victory in the Pacific theatre.
FEATURES: A balsa skeleton framework is assembled and covered with a tissue
and dope finish.
Designed to be flown rubber powered, .049 free flight or .09
control line.
The fuselage is roomy enough to accept simple R/C equipment (with a
.049-.07 engine) but instructions and diagrams for this are not
included.
Makes a magnificent display piece if built as a non-flying model.
Operating bomb trapeze.
Retractable landing gear.
Moveable dive brakes.
Sliding canopy.
Machine gun/access panel.
Movable tail surfaces.
Scale combat pilot figure.
Extremely detailed instructions on various sheets in kit.
INCLUDES: Decals; scale WWII plastic wheels; plastic nose cowl; hub and
spinner; exhaust ports; twin machine guns; one large droppable
bomb; two small fixed bombs; landing gear struts; tailwheel struc-
ture; clear bubble canopy; two-color cockpit interior; wide-blade
prop; 6' rubber thread; light silkspan; die-cut balsa parts; clay
for balancing model; reinforced wire landing gear; generous quanti-
ties of strip stock; plywood firewall; tip guide; bellcrank base;
control line handle; pushrod wire; bellcrank; elevator horn; hinge
material; nylon flying line; stock for all balsa tail surfaces.
